A Team Effort Seals Victory
Last night the Wisconsin Badgers took on the Boston College Eagles in the first game of their home opener series. The arena echoed with cheers as Lacey Eden, Sarah Wozniewicz, Marianne Piard, Britta Curl, and Chayla Edwards took turns to find the net for the Badgers. With this game, Wisconsin now has an impressive eight straight wins over the Eagles.
Boston College attempted a win after Wozniewicz's early goal, momentarily leading 3-2 at the end of the first period. But the Badgers' determination was on display as Piard tied early in the second period. Curl's goal reclaimed the lead for Wisconsin. Chayla Edwards delivered a blow late in the third period, marking her second career goal
Looking Ahead
The Badgers are all set to conclude their series against the Eagles with a game at LaBahn Arena, at 7 p.m. this Friday. In what promises to be a special evening, the 2023 NCAA Championship Banner will be unveiled at 6:45 p.m. Star players from last year's NCAA championship squad will be at the event. Though tickets for the match are sold out, fans can catch the action live on 1070 AM or B1G+.
